Abstract

Biomechanical loading of limbs, which may influence the risk of musculoskeletal injury, is affected both by conformation and by the position of the limbs (dynamic loading) during the stance phase of the stride. Despite many anecdotal reports of associations between conformation and lameness, there is only limited evidence-based information.
